30 November 1955
Mother reads from {The Synthesis of Yoga},
“The Four Aids”.
How is Time a friend?
It depends on how you look at it. Everything
depends on the relation you have with it. If you take it as a friend, it
becomes a friend. If you consider it as an enemy, it becomes your enemy.
But that's not what you are asking. What
you are asking is how one feels when it is an enemy and how when it is a
friend. Well, when you become impatient and tell yourself, “Oh, I must succeed
in doing this and why don't I succeed in doing it?” and when you don't succeed
immediately in doing it and fall into despair, then it is your enemy. But when

19 January 1955
This talk is
based upon Bases of Yoga, Chapter 3,
“In Difficulty”.
Sweet Mother, what is
the work of the higher mind?
Work?
What exactly do you want to know? What it ought to do? Or what should one…?
Its role.
The
role of the higher mind? It ought to receive inspirations from above, ought to transmit
them in the form of ideas to the most material mind, so that the latter may
execute things, make formations. It serves as an intermediary between the
higher power and the active mind. The higher mind is a mind of idea-formation
